With two audits and new A.I., can Facebook fix its discrimination problems?

After the recent farce of a congressional hearing about "anti-conservative bias" on social media, Facebook wants the world to know it's still taking this alleged issue seriously.

Facebook shared Wednesday that it will undergo a thorough political bias review, led by former Republican senator Jon Kyl and his lobbying firm, Covington and Burling. According to the firm's website, Kyl is an expert in helping corporations navigate domestic and international policy. The conservative think tank Heritage Foundation will also take part in the independent review.
